This pistachio ice cream dessert is a refreshing, light dessert; a nice treat for St. Patrick's Day or any special occasion. My husband and son will eat a whole 9x13-inch dish in less than a week!
Ingredients
- 2 sleevess buttery round crackers , crushed
- 0.5 cups unsalted butter , melted
Instructions
-
1
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
-
2
Combine cracker crumbs and melted butter in a bowl. Mix until evenly moistened; press into the bottom and sides of a 9x13-inch baking dish.
-
3
Bake in the preheated oven until crust lightly browned and smells toasted, about 15 minutes. Remove from the oven and cool.
-
4
Combine ice cream, milk, and pudding mix in a bowl; spread evenly onto prepared crust. Spread whipped topping over ice cream mixture; top with toffee bits. Place in freezer until hardened, at least 1 hour.
